The job duties of a community health worker often include: Meet with clients in the community to assess their health needs and goals. In this article, we define health science and provide a …Some employers require only a high school diploma, while others require a college degree. Community health workers typically receive up to 100 hours of additional training on the job, through classroom study, job mentoring or a combination. Community health workers are not licensed, but employers may set continuing education requirements.The Bureau of Labor Statistics projects 15.9% employment growth for community health workers between 2021 and 2031.
